I have been battling a problem on a 7206 all day, and I am stressing over
it. 7206 with a PA-MC-2T3+. I tried 12.0(19)S1 and 12.0(7)XE1 and both
are showing the same problems. Type 7 LSA's are not being translated to
Type 5 LSA's for redistribution in the backbone.

To run a Multichannel interface, CCO says you need at least 12.0(1)S or
12.0(2)XE2.

I have an NSSA on this 7206 (area 10). The 7206 is an ABR between area 10
and 0. The NSSA is configured correctly, the 7206 is getting all the Type
7 LSA's. The braindead 7206 is announcing Type 5 LSA's for other parts of
ospf (such as redistributed statics, connected, etc). But its not doign
the 7->5 conversion for routes learned from the NSSA.
